âHe was stoking these fears not just of Second Amendment infringements, but of trampling and confiscation of individual liberties across the board,â said reporter Jeremy Peters. âThatâs what he said, and itâs an interesting shift in strategy for a group like the NRA which no longer has a president in the White House to demean and to demonize and to make an enemy of, so what theyâve done is theyâve said, âOkay, thereâs a much broader conspiracy â itâs no longer coming just from the Democrats, itâs coming from the media, itâs coming from the intel community, itâs coming from the government and they are going to get you, and the ultimate goal is to take your guns.ââ
But the speech didnât seem to go over well with younger conservative activists, Peters said, prompting LaPierre to re-enact Jeb Bushâs infamous âplease clapâ moment.
âThe room was not with Wayne LaPierre yesterday,â Peters said. âActually, at one point he stopped and he said, âI sense itâs a little quiet out there.â It was quiet, he said, because they must be scared and all gun owners should be. But the reason they were quiet is because they werenât buying what he was selling.â
